The Intel Atom CPU Z3735F is a quad-core processor from the Bay Trail-M family, released in 2014. It operates at a clock speed of 1.33 GHz and features a burst frequency of up to 1.83 GHz. This processor is commonly used in netbooks, tablets, and other low-power devices.

The Intel Atom CPU Z3735F is built on a 22nm process, which allows for a more compact design and improved power management. This processor features four cores, each with a clock speed of 1.33 GHz, and a burst frequency of up to 1.83 GHz.
